Sherried London Broil With Herb Butter
- 1 (3 lb) london broil beef, 2 to 2 1/2 inches thick
- Marinade
- 4 tablespoons oil
- 1 cup dry sherry
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- 1 onion
- 1 teaspoon dried rosemary
- 10 black peppercorns
- Herb Butter
- 1/4 cup butter, softened
- 2 teaspoons fresh parsley
- 2 teaspoons chives, minced
- 2 teaspoons dry sherry
- 1 dash hot sauce
- Combine marinade ingredients in a flat shallow dish.
- Cover and marinate in the refrigerator for 8 hours or overnight, turning the meat occasionally.
- Allow the meat to stand for one hour at room temperature.
- Broil/grill 5- 10" mins per side, depending on your preference for doneness.
- Spread the soft herb butter over the meat and slice across the grain.
